It is assumed everyone uses 488nm blue but not everyone will have just one laser setup.
If a model was trained on a different wavelength laser it won't transfer.
As well as laser wavelength, detector wavelengths are not tied to a specific number. The channels are just "red" not e.g. 600nm
As of now, this would require cyz2json updates, possibly even cyzAPI updates, before bringing that updated version into flowcytometertool and accessing the wavelength data.
